So who are Full Moon Morris?
We are a mixed Cotswold Morris dancing side loosely based around South Wales, UK, although our members come from as far afield as the far west of Swansea, the Forest of Dean and even Devon and Norfolk...
How we began...
Full Moon Morris started early in 1997, when six men and women who danced with various local sides in South Wales wanted to "get out more". Initially we learnt three dances to perform when we accompanied Shoostring Appalachian Dancers to the South West of Ireland at Easter 1997. Our first musician joined us at that point, practising the tunes outside our rented cottage on the first day of the trip.
At the time we had no plans beyond that - however such was the interest amongst our travelling companions that many of them joined us in the following months, plus other local dancers once the word got around. By the end of the year we had around 20 dancers and musicians.
And the name...?
Contrary to popular belief, our name is not derived from certain habits of our male members. In fact we take our name from a small hamlet near to Cross Keys in the South Wales valleys. There's not much to see of the hamlet now, but the Full Moon name lives on in a roundabout on the nearby A467 dual carriageway!
Upton upon Severn Folk Festival
Upton Folk Festival takes place in the town of Upton upon Severn, Worcestershire, annually, the first May Bank Holiday Weekend. The festival features a full programme of concerts, song and music sessions, ceilidhs and workshops as well as a procession through the town at midday on Sunday, and Morris and other dance displays throughout the weekend.
